Kix focuses on the Birmingham, Alabama protests in the spring of 1963.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. drew national attention to the abuses heaped on black people in a town nicknamed โBombinghamโ because of the routine White Terrorism. Children took the starring role in the upheaval as Racist Eugene โBullโ Connor used police canines and fire hoses to brutalize black people.
